Q. Will I be in control and aware of what is happening?
A. Yes, all the time. You are in an alternative state of consciousness You can hear everything that is being said. Nothing happens without your consent. You have absolute control. However, you are extremely relaxed.
Q. Will I remember what happens during the sessions?
A. Yes, people remember everything they or the therapist said during the session. In rare instances the therapist might need to remind them of one or two points that were talked about in order to trigger off the rest of the memory. 
Q. Is hypnosis suitable for children?
A. Yes, usually from about the age of six, provided they can understand what is being said, In 1981 self hypnosis was introduced into the national curriculum in Sweden. For children under the age of six, sleep hypnosis can be conducted with great success.
Q. Will the therapist have to touch me?
A. Some therapists will touch you on the wrist, shoulder, neck or forehead to test whether you are properly relaxed or to assist you into a deeper state of hypnosis. They will seek your permission first. Other than this form of contact, a therapist has no business touching you.

Q. Will I do anything against my will?
A. No, you will not do anything that you do not think is acceptable or against your nature.
